The Millennium Cohort Study.

open access: yesPopulation trends, 2002
The Millennium Cohort Study is the latest in the line of British birth cohort studies. MCS resembles its predecessors which follow people born in 1946, 1958 and 1970 in the intention to become multi-purpose longitudinal data resource charting many aspects of individual's lives over time.

Germline variants in CDKN2A wild‐type melanoma prone families

open access: yesMolecular Oncology, EarlyView.
Among melanoma‐prone families, wild‐type for CDKN2A and CDK4, some have pathogenic variants in genes not usually linked to melanoma. Furthermore, rare XP‐related variants and variants in MC1R are enriched in such families.
